Hebes are a large family of evergreen shrubs grown for both their foliage and attractive flower spikes. Some are fully hardy and others need winter protection. They should be grown in poor or moderately fertile, moist but well-drained, neutral to slightly alkaline soil, in a sunny position or partial shade. They need shelter from cold drying winds. They make excellent plants for a shrubbery, in warmer areas for ornamental hedges, or the smaller species for planting in containers.Hebe Mrs. Winder is a compact rounded form often grown for its very attractive glossy foliage which emerges reddish-purple then maturing to dark grey-green on purplish brown shoots. Bright violet-blue flowers which are attractive to pollinators from August to October. This variety will tolerate partial shade. Height 1m, spread 1.5m.
